Sioux City school board holds closed session to evaluate staff competency and review confidential records
Summary
The Sioux City Community School District board of directors voted to enter closed session to evaluate the professional competency of an individual and to review records required to be kept confidential under state or federal law, then returned to open session and adjourned the special meeting.
The Sioux City Community School District board of directors held a special meeting Jan. 29 and voted to enter closed session to evaluate the professional competency of an individual and to review records that must remain confidential under state or federal law, citing Iowa Code section 21.5(1)(a).
